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Andean walnut | Pallid Ground Squirrel |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Fagales (Beeches & Oaks)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Juglandaceae | Sciuridae (Squirrels) |
| Genus | Juglans | Spermophilus |
| Species | Juglans neotropica | Spermophilus pallidicauda |
